Accelerating dynamic network marketplaces

URN C25.0.836
Topics CaaS (Connectivity as a Service), Marketplaces, Network as a Service (NaaS)

Accelerating network marketplaces through automation using APIs and Gen AI

As CSPs expand into hyperscaler, B2B and third-party markets, they are increasingly offering flexible network-as-a-service (NaaS) products and bundles. This Catalyst accelerates development of such network marketplaces by using CAMARA, TM Forum, and MEF APIs to streamline site-to-cloud VPN provisioning across multiple operators. This helps CSPs and hyperscalers rapidly launch multi-vendor services, cutting time-to-market and reducing costs through automated planning. In contrast to traditional manual methods, the APIs enable users to create and configure multi-site, multi-cloud network connections dynamically through a one-click marketplace interface. CSPs can thereby streamline the ordering and provisioning of network services. By orchestrating IP VPN connections across metropolitan and backbone networks, operators can easily deliver virtual private network services tailored to customer requirements. The integration of CAMARA, TM Forum (TMF), and Metro Ethernet Forum (MEF) APIs will facilitate end-to-end provisioning of VPN services across multiple operators, fostering seamless third-party marketplace integration. This capability empowers CSPs and hyperscalers to rapidly launch innovative multi-vendor services, dramatically reducing lead times from months to weeks. By enabling seamless marketplace integration, and abstracting network complexity through automated deployment processes powered by generative AI, CSPs can therefore efficiently manage and monetize their network assets. Key benefits include: 1. Accelerated service innovation and ecosystem expansion 2. Significant cost savings due to automated planning, projecting up to 25% reductions in capital and operational expenses over five years 3. Streamlined network deployments and improved operational efficiency By adopting these APIs and secure integration frameworks, CSPs can significantly enhance competitiveness, driving customer acquisition as well as innovation and profitability. Industries benefiting from the enhanced network service automation made possible include finance, education, healthcare, IoT, cloud services, virtual conferencing, and more. Contributions to standards by TM Forum and the Linux Foundation Networking (LFN) through defining and orchestrating these APIs will then support wider adoption across the industry.
